Scotts Valley-Carmel football

Central Coast Section Playoffs
Division IV
Friday's game
No. 6 Scotts Valley (8-2) vs. No. 3 Carmel (10-0) at Pacific Grove, 7 p.m.
 The 47.2 points per game average in 10 regular season games is a new Monterey County record for the Padres, who are 10-0 for the third time in five years.
 Carmel's first ever playoff win came in 2009 against Scotts Valley when it posted a 61-28 decision en route to a CCS Division IV title.
 Holden Smith is over 1,000 yards rushing for the third straight year for the Padres while quarterback Connor Marden is over 2,000 passing yards for the second straight year.
 Scotts Valley's only setbacks are to Santa Cruz Coast Athletic League champion Aptos and Nevada state power Spanish Springs.
 Jake Rehnberg has rushed for 2,018 yards for the Falcons and 15 touchdowns, while Willie Johnston has piled up just under 800 yards and 12 touchdowns.
 Johnston also leads the team with 32 catches and seven touchdowns. Scotts Valley has scored 40 or more points five times this year.
